- Title
- Object: The Village Festival
- Description
-
A village square at dusk, with many villagers drinking outside at wooden tables on the left, and the balcony of the inn, one man being dragged forward to dance by others, including a woman and little girl, while a dog runs ahead of his feet, and other children point to a drunkard lying alongside the troughs at the water-pump; after Wilkie; scratched-letter proof. 1839
Stipple and mezzotint
